McIlroy to skip Grand Slam of Golf

US PGA champion Rory McIlroy will not take part in the Grand Slam of Golf later this year due to a scheduling conflict.
The Grand Slam of Golf, which pits the year's four major winners against each other over a 36-hole strokeplay event, takes place on October 23 and 24 at Bermuda's Port Royal Golf Course.
But McIlroy has already declared himself for the European Tour's BMW Masters, played at Lake Malaren Golf Club in Shanghai from October 25-28.
Keegan Bradley, the 2011 US PGA champion and winner of last year's Grand Slam of Golf, replaces McIlroy and will be up against Bubba Watson, Webb Simpson and Ernie Els.
